The State of Hydraulic Machinery in Equatorial Guinea

Analyzing the intersection of oil-driven economic growth and equipment durability requirements.

In Equatorial Guinea, the industrial sector is heavily influenced by the hydrocarbon industry and the growing urban infrastructure in Malabo. The high humidity and saline coastal environment create significant corrosion risks for standard hydraulic components, making the demand for high-grade single acting hydraulic cylinder units critical for long-term operational stability.

Current market trends show a shift from basic manual lifting to mechanized logistics. The adoption of a professional combined hydraulic cylinder system is becoming standard for construction firms looking to optimize load-bearing efficiency in challenging tropical terrains.

However, many local operators still struggle with outdated power units that lack thermal protection. There is a growing necessity for specialized automotive lifting power unit systems that can operate reliably under high ambient temperatures without suffering from hydraulic oil degradation.

Market Development History

Prior to 2010, the Equatorial Guinean market relied heavily on imported second-hand machinery with simple mechanical actuators. Basic lifting was achieved through rudimentary systems, often lacking the precision of a modern wingspan power unit, resulting in high maintenance costs and low safety standards.

Between 2010 and 2020, as the energy sector expanded, there was a transition toward integrated hydraulic power packs. The introduction of the tailboard power unit revolutionized the local logistics sector, allowing for safer and faster unloading of heavy equipment in port zones.

From 2021 to the present, the focus has shifted toward "Smart Hydraulics." We are seeing an integration of electronic control valves with high-pressure cylinders, reducing energy consumption and increasing the lifespan of components through precision pressure regulation.

Common Hydraulic Questions in Equatorial Guinea

Expert answers to technical challenges faced by local operators.

How to prevent corrosion in a single acting hydraulic cylinder in coastal Malabo?

We recommend using high-performance zinc-nickel plating or specialized epoxy coatings specifically designed for high-salinity environments to prevent oxidation and pitting.

Which combined hydraulic cylinder is best for heavy lifting in oil rigs?

For oil rig applications, a multi-stage combined cylinder with reinforced guide rods and high-pressure seals is ideal to handle uneven loads and high-impact stresses.

What are the maintenance requirements for a tailboard power unit in tropical climates?

Regularly check the hydraulic oil viscosity and replace filters every 500 hours to prevent moisture contamination, which is common in Equatorial Guinea's humid air.
